Child Psychologists for Families in Georgia

A family therapist works at helping couples, parents, and children to feel closer through communication and understanding. Therapists help families cope with everyday challenges such as feelings of disconnection, unhealthy communication patterns, and behavioral challenges as well as in the wake of major life transitions including divorce and death.
